Output 89e8643a88365eafc0ae8f36d49c8523b937b63b88c65275a09505fcecc22a83:0

value
24682060
script pubkey
OP_0 OP_PUSHBYTES_20 1673fc349985f648ace81788280b2a32afc7bfd3
address
ltc1qzeelcdyeshmy3t8gz7yzsze2x2hu007nd464g6
transaction
89e8643a88365eafc0ae8f36d49c8523b937b63b88c65275a09505fcecc22a83
spent
true